Charlotte County detectives seek information on cattle rustling off I-75
Charlotte County Sheriff’s detectives are asking the public if they saw anything early Monday morning along I-75 related to cattle rustling. The brazen incident occurred along the busy interstate sometime after midnight and daybreak. Detectives say nine cows and one bull were loaded into a fifth-wheel cattle/horse trailer pulled by a truck which was parked alongside southbound I-75 between the Airport Road overpass and Jones Loop Road exit-161. The cattle thieves cut the fence to the adjacent pasture and then herded the cattle into the trailer, then drove off.
